Making one’s home a conducive place for living in style and peace is a homeowner’s dream. The styles may vary and the perception of peace may differ too. Bottom line though is the same - it should be a home that one can live in happily, comfortably and easily. Home is where we go to after each day and the first place we often seek for comfort and rest. Here comes the importance of home decorating. Now don’t panic just yet. Decorating can be done without spending lots of cash or swiping your credit card to tatters.

Shop in budget-friendly places - thrift stores, discount shops, flea markets, yard sales, EBay, your friend’s house (if she’s selling some of her stuff). These outlets may sound cheap but you may be surprised with the goods they have. For all you know, you might just find your treasure trove from the flea market.

Another way to decorate on a budget is to make decorations out of common items. Buy cheap frames from a dollar store and fill them with things that are not traditional artwork. Items that make you smile or think contribute significantly to filling a space. They express your personality in your living environment.

Instead of wallpapering, you can repaint the walls. Several cans of paint are still way cheaper than wallpapers and paying for wallpapering service.

For wall hangings, you can opt for your own photographs and artworks you can buy in thrift stores. With a nice frame, a simple wall decor will look ten times more attractive. An area rug also makes an impressive wall hanging. It’s unique and eye-catching.

It is really important to remember to have fun when decorating. You also need to make choices that you can live with happily. Avoid the temptation of doing something that is going to become old quickly and only make purchases that you are going to be able to live with.

There are just so many cheap decorative items that you can use. Flowers and plants don’t cost much, especially if you grow your own bunch in the garden, but they look colorful and beautiful in any room. Smaller fabrics like throw pillow covers are not that pricey but they do so much in making a living room more attractive. These are just some examples of cheap but highly effective decorating ideas. Check out your own stuff and you might just find everything you need without making a trip to the stores.
